Description
This project aims to develop real-time ultrasound technology, specifically Robust Short-Lag Spatial Coherence (R-SLSC) imaging, to distinguish fluid-filled from solid masses, simplifying clinical workflows and improving diagnostic confidence. It addresses the challenge of acoustic clutter in dense breasts that complicates differentiation between benign and malignant masses, with the goal of improving early breast cancer detection.
